Transcription

14th ffebruary 1651

Repeated before}
doctor Exton one of}
the Judges et cetera}

The personall answers of Robert
Bagnoll made to the positions of an
allegation given in againt him on
the behalfe of William Stephens
doe followe.

To the first pretended position hee
answereth and beleeveth that the shippe
the Constant was built twelve or thirteene
yeares agoe as this rendent hath heard
And otherwise for his parte hee doth not
beleeve the said position to be true in
any parte thereof.

To the second pretended position hee
answereth that for his parte hee doth not
beleeve the said position to bee true in
any parte thereof.

To the third pretended position hee
answereth that for his parte hee doth
not beleeve the said position to bee true in
any parte thereof.

To the fourth pretensed position hee
answereth hat for his parte hee doth not
beleeve the said position to bee true in any
parte thereof.

To the 5.th pretended position hee answereth
and accepteth the contents of this position soe
farr as the same doe make for him and not
otherwise and beleeveth that the yeares 1645.
1646. and 1647 the arlate ffletcher did goe in
